Over-the-counter wasp sprays force property owners into close physical contact with defensive colonies while dispersing low-pressure chemical mists that agitate stinging insects. When disturbed, paper wasps and aggressive aerial yellowjackets deploy alarm pheromones that trigger swarm attacks across yards and patios. Professional extraction replaces consumer spray guesswork with high-reach aerosol micro-injections and protective suits, neutralizing the entire brood core instantaneously without scattering aggressive foragers into nearby living areas.
In humid Gulf Coast microclimates across Houston Heights, Montrose, and River Oaks, prolonged heat accelerates queen reproductive cycles, allowing open-comb umbrella nests under porch ceilings, exposed rafters, and deep overhangs to double in size within fourteen days. Seasonal downpours near Buffalo Bayou Park and Memorial Park regularly flood natural ground burrows, driving subterranean yellowjackets into brick weep screeds, wall voids, and detached garage facings in Oak Forest and Meyerland.
